Abstract :
In this study, the matching pursuit (MP) method has been proposed to enhance the respiratory-related evoked responses (RREPs) using only a few dominant atoms of the time-frequency energy distribution. This approach permits the authors to apply RREPs analysis to situations not permitting such long trial sessions
